What is Almere?

Almere is a city in the Netherlands, located in the province of Flevoland. It is the seventh largest city / municipality in the country, with a population of over 200,000 people. Almere is a relatively new city, having been founded in 1976, and has since grown to become a vibrant and modern city. It is known for its beautiful natural surroundings, with a number of parks, lakes, and beaches. The city also has a thriving economy, with a variety of businesses, industries, and educational institutions.
